Digga-Leg is a boss in Super Mario Galaxy 2. He is encountered after Mario makes his way to the planet the boss is residing on. Digga-Leg vastly resembles a smaller version of Megaleg from Super Mario Galaxy, with his weak spot being his underside, which contains a Power Star. However, this version only has two legs, and his eyes emit a red glow. Mario's only option is to drill through the planet with a Spin Drill from wherever Digga-Leg is not and strike his underside.

Digga-Leg's primary methods of attack are to stomp around his small, rocky planetoid in the Spin-Dig Galaxy, and to summon Diggas. If, and when it gets annoyed, it will jump into the air and kill Mario if he gets crushed. When Digga-Leg gets hit three times with the drill, it will calm right down, blow up, and hand over his Power Star. The Power Star's name is Diggaleg's Planet. When Mario gets enough Comet Medals a Prankster Comet comes to the Spin-Dig Galaxy. This comet unlocks Digga-Leg's Daredevil Run. In this level Mario has only one health bar and he cannot get any more. But instead of having to do the entire level, Mario is sent straight to Digga-Leg's planetoid. Digga-Leg is powered by a new Power Star but the battle is the same, except for the fact that Mario cannot get hit by anything, or else he will lose a life.

Trivia

  • Digga-Leg shares his boss music with the Whomp King.
  • Digga-Leg's battle style is similar to Raphael the Raven's from Super Mario World 2: Yoshi's Island and it's port.
  • Unlike most large enemies, if Mario is hit by Digga-Leg's legs, he simply gets knocked away and takes damage instead of getting crushed and insta-killed. Thus, Digga-Leg is one of the two bosses in Super Mario Galaxy 2 (or rather, the franchise) whose crush attack does not cause an immediate death. The Bouldergeist is the other.
  • Digga-Leg was originally going to be called "Digg-Leg", but this was changed in the final version of the game for unknown reasons.
  • Digga-Leg can also be seen on his planet in the background of the Super Mario Galaxy 2 Puzzle Swap panel in StreetPass Mii Plaza for the Nintendo 3DS.
